h2. Documentation Project
18 1 Anonymous
19 7 Tom Clegg
The Arvados documentation is written in Markdown, Textile, and HTML. The source code is in the @doc@ directory in the Arvados source tree. We use Jekyll to render HTML pages.

h2. Contributing
22 1 Anonymous
23 7 Tom Clegg
Bugs in the documentation can be submitted as "issues":/projects/arvados/issues.
24 6 Tom Clegg
25 12 Anonymous
To contribute to the documentation, clone the Arvados source repository, edit, and send pull requests just as you would when contributing program source code.
26 6 Tom Clegg
27
We do not yet maintain a separate documentation mailing list, so we encourage documentation contributors to join the main developer mailing list.
